Title :
An auditory onset detection algorithm for improved automatic source localization

Abstract :
An algorithm is described which detects auditory onsets quickly in arbitrary binaural audio streams. Aspects of the precedence effect are implemented to speed up computation, and to increase the usability of the output. The onset detector is tested with a number of binaural signals. Onsets that are suitable for spatial auditory processing are found reliably. This will allow spatial feature extraction to be performed.
